Just favorite little local park. It offers a nice play area for kids, good fishing spots, a .75 mile track to run on, and workout stations on said running path. The family loves when the heron's are there. Great park for all ages.

We had some time to kill and I wanted my little one to burn off some energy before nap time. This was the closest playground, so we came here. It's a huge park with a large pond. Great for walking with friends, family or the dog. But as far as playgrounds go, it was only so-so. It was certainly pretty unique, but not very big or entertaining for a toddler. Also, bonus points for a playground with ample shade. This didn't have that either.

History: The 46 acre park was dedicated in 1974. The park includes 21 acres of land and 24 acres of lake water.Amenities: 2 fishing lakes playground 0.75 mile bike/pedestrian trail around the lake with fitness equipment 2 sand volleyball courts Picnic Shelter (Reservable) Gazebo (Reservable - Great outdoor wedding location!)Watch out for the geese/ducks.
